"USENET" A raytraced scene by Chris Herborth (cherborth@semprini.waterloo-rdp.on.ca) (c) 1995 When I read the subject for the March/95 comp.graphics.raytracing contest ("The Internet"), this image of USENET immediately sprung to mind. Simple, ironic, and to-the-point. I don't expect this to win, but it's fun. :-) The awesome flame texture was posted to the DKB-L (POV-Ray/DKB Trace mailing list); unfortunately, I forgot to save the message headers, so I don't know who to thank! Instead, I'll just thank everyone on the mailing list. Thanks everyone! The rest of the scene was modelled by hand in an hour or so. This only takes about 20 minutes or so to trace at 1024x768 on a '486dx2/66 running OS/2 (my system at work); it'd probably take a day on my Atari ST...
